Banfield Estate Agents are delighted to present to the market this two bedroom semi detached house, nestled in a popular location on the outskirts of Crowborough yet still offering convenient access to the High Street, local schools and open fields/ countryside. The ground floor of this property consists of an entrance porch, living room, and kitchen/ dining room. To the first floor you will find two double bedrooms both benefitting from built in wardrobes, family bathroom and separate WC. Externally the property boasts a large driveway, single garage and a beautifully manicured garden to the rear. Entrance

An opaque UPVC double glazed front door with detailing, leading to:-

Entrance Porch

Dual aspect with UPVC double glazed windows to the front and side. Part glazed door to:-

Living Room

A generous reception room which offers plenty of space for living room furniture. UPVC double glazed French doors opening out to the rear garden. Part glazed door to the stairs rising to the first floor. Two radiators. Door to:-

Kitchen/ Dining Room

A range of wooden wall and base units line one end of this sizeable room, with complimentary laminate worktop, creating ample storage and preparation space with fully tiled splashbacks. Stainless steel sink and drainer sits beneath UPVC double glazed window to the front. 'Belling' cooker with gas hob. There is space for an undercounter fridge as well as space and plumbing for a washing machine. Wall mounted gas fired boiler. Tiled flooring. The other end of room offers additional wooden base units and glass fronted wall units with laminate worktop creating further storage and allows comfortably for a family dining table and seating area, if desired. UPVC double glazed windows to the side and rear. Opaque UPVC double glazed door leading out to the side. Two radiators.

First Floor

Landing

UPVC double glazed window in the stairwell and a second window at the top of the stairs to the front. Loft hatch. Doors to:-

Bedroom One

A generous double bedroom benefitting from fitted wardrobes with mirrored doors to one side, offering both hanging and shelving storage. UPVC double glazed window overlooking the lovely rear garden, radiator below. Airing cupboard housing the hot water tank and offering further slatted shelving for storage.

Bedroom Two

Another good size bedroom, again benefitting from built in wardrobes offering both hanging and folding storage. Space for further furniture, if required. UPVC double glazed window to the rear with radiator, below.

Family Bathroom

This fully tiled suite comprises of a panel bath with chrome taps and wall mounted 'Triton Coral' shower over. Useful vanity storage unit with sink inset above. UPVC opaque double glazed window to the side. Radiator.

WC

Separate fully tiled WC comprising of push handle flush toilet. UPVC double glazed opaque window to the front.

Rear Garden

A large area of patio runs across the rear of the property, creating a space ideal for outside dining and entertaining or alternatively somewhere to sit back and relax. Beyond the patio the neatly manicured garden is mainly laid to lawn with flower beds bursting full of mature flowers and shrubs lining the perimeter.

Garage & Parking

Single garage with electric up and over door to the front and benefitting from power and light. UPVC double glazed opaque window to the rear and UPVC double glazed door with opaque panel to the side. In front of the garage is a large block paved driveway providing parking comfortably for several vehicles. Outside tap.
